Junior Compensation & Benefits Specialist(m/w/x)
Job architecture and catalogue maintenance using Mercer IPE methodology for a global gaming company. First experience in job evaluation procedures preferred. Daily administration of European rewards and benefits systems.
Requirements
- University degree in Business Administration, Data Analytics, Finance, or comparable qualification
- Solid proficiency in Compensation & Benefits or Total Rewards
- First experience in job architecture methodology and evaluation procedures preferred
- Solid MS Office proficiency, especially Excel and PowerPoint
- Basic Power BI and SAP HCM skills are a plus
- Other programming skills would be a plus
- Very good analytical thinking
- Ability to translate complex compensation into clear insights for Senior Management
- Very good English skills
- Another European language is a plus
- Position may be Junior depending on professional experience
Tasks
- Lead job evaluation activities using Mercer IPE methodology
- Maintain and enhance job architecture and job catalogue
- Ensure accurate documentation of all roles
- Oversee and administer European rewards and benefits systems
- Conduct salary analyses and labour market benchmarking
- Participate in salary surveys and interpret data
- Update salary bands for fair and competitive rewards
- Monitor internal pay equity
- Analyze gender pay gap
- Implement sustainable solutions for pay transparency
- Develop and maintain compensation policies and procedures
- Create and update communication materials
- Support consistent application of reward frameworks
- Partner with internal stakeholders across Europe
- Participate in European HR project development
- Implement and administer European HR projects
